1

Details, Fiction and Sports App

News Discuss 
Want the largest news and match updates from the team sent immediate to your cell phone or pill? Then download the BBC Sport app and enroll to notifications. , 03/31/2022 The Rating: The last word Sports App If I had to pick a location to get all of my sports https://www.ted.com/profiles/47383141

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story